#18786d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#18786d is composed of 9.4% red, 47.1%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.2%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 173.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 28.2%. #18786d color hex could be obtained by blending #30f0da with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#18786d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010605 is the darkest color, while #f4fd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#18786d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444c4b is the less saturated color, while #028e7e is the most saturated one.
